Sign 2 – Lack of Flexibility

“The only sustainable advantage you can have over others is agility, that’s it.”—Jeff Bezos

How can you assess whether your system will deliver the flexibility and agility you require? Ask yourself these questions:

  • Do you have to call your vendor when you need a new report, dashboard, or workflow created?
  • Are you constantly paying for new features and modifications to fit how you are running your programs?
  • Is it difficult to drive best practices that deliver program efficiency?
  • Does it take time and money to make updates or changes to your system in order to respond to market disruptions or act on promising opportunities?
  • Are you having issues deploying the system across your network to be used everywhere and by every user involved in the program?

If the answer to any of these questions is yes, it is time to evaluate how you are running your capital programs.
